
#DEBUG=-DDEBUG
DEBUG=

INC=c:\windrv\inc
TOOLS=c:\c6
TOOLS32=c:\windrv\tools\32bit
MASMDIR=c:\masm
ZIPDIR=c:\zip
TASMDIR=c:\tasm

.asm.obj:
            $(TOOLS32)\masm5 -p -w2 -Mx $(DEBUG) -I$(INC) $*;

.asm.lst:
            $(TOOLS32)\masm5 -l -p -w2 -Mx $(DEBUG) -I$(INC) $*;

all         :   vvmd.386 tstvm.exe

vvmd.386    :   vvmd.def vvmd.obj
                $(TOOLS32)\link386 @vvmd.lnk
                $(TOOLS32)\addhdr vvmd.386
                $(TOOLS32)\mapsym32 vvmd

vvmd.obj    :   vvmd.asm

tstvm.exe   :   tstvm.obj
                $(TASMDIR)\tlink /3 /v $*

tstvm.obj   :   tstvm.asm
                $(TASMDIR)\tasm /Zi /l /m3 $*

# MISC. STUFF

zip     :   clean
            $(ZIPDIR)\pkzip vvmd.zip 

clean   :
            del *.386
            del *.map
            del *.sym
            del *.obj
            del *.exe
            del *.zip
